Buying a rally car for enthusiasts in 2026 involves a choice between modern "rally-bred" road cars and budget-friendly classics for amateur racing. The market currently favors versatile all-wheel drive (AWD) models like the and Toyota GR Yaris , which offer factory-engineered performance for both gravel and pavement.
